Child support payments are granted when one parent maintains primary custody of the child(ren) during divorce in South Dakota.

Child Support payments are legally enforceable by a court issued order. The parent without primary custody is normally required to help pay for expenses of the children like food, clothing, housing, education and medical treatment.
